La historia

Caillebotte painted this from his own apartment window, at the corner of the rue Gluck and the boulevard Haussmann in Paris. That boulevard was only a couple of decades old, one of the broad straight avenues cut through the medieval city during Baron Haussmann's vast rebuilding. The well-dressed man leans at the railing with his back to us, looking down at the traffic and trees below, so we end up watching the city over his shoulder. Caillebotte was wealthy enough that he never needed to sell his work, and he returned again and again to this kind of scene: men at windows and on balconies, gazing out at the newly modern streets they lived above.
